Clockwork Staircase tattoo design: a cover-up-ready concept with intricate pattern.

This AI-generated tattoo project concept presents a clockwork timepiece perched within a sweeping staircase, rendered in black and grey with careful light, shade, and texture. The central clock face reveals gears and hands, signaling time’s inexorable march, while the ascent of the stairs evokes memory, progress, and personal transformation. Surrounding this focal element, smoke-like wisps blur the periphery, adding depth and a sense of movement that ties the mechanical core to the skin. Pencil-border accents along the outer edges give a sketch-like preview feel, signaling a design concept for a real tattoo. The composition relies on strong contrast and negative space to achieve a realistic tattoo effect, with the black and grey palette ensuring longevity and versatile placement on the forearm, shoulder, or chest. Symbolically, the clock and stairs tell a story of time traversed and goals pursued, a meaningful tattoo for those drawn to change, endurance, and introspection. The piece can be adapted to different scales, from a compact inner-forearm piece to a larger sleeve, and can incorporate blossoms or koi to align with Japanese or floral themes while preserving the core mechanical motif. The design showcases techniques associated with fine line tattoo and realistic tattoo styles, delivering crisp gears and numerals, smooth gradient shading for the clock housing, and subtle feathering to suggest smoke. These are AI-generated tattoo projects intended as starting points for a custom tattoo design that a skilled artist can refine into personalized body art. If the goal is a cover-up, the density of shading and complexity of the gears offer excellent concealment while maintaining a striking silhouette. Key elements to translate include the clock face with numerals, the staircase, the gears, the smoky shading, and the pencil-border texture that can taper into skin during inking.
